  • Patent number: 8713036
    Abstract: Techniques involving an abstract derived entity. The abstract derived entity is a data object present in an abstract data model that may be referenced by other entities in the abstract data model as though it were a relational table present in a physical data source. The abstract data model provides data access independent of the manner in which the data is physically represented in a set of physical data sources. The abstract derived entity may be used to provide aggregate data joined with other non-aggregate data. The abstract derived entity may describe a relational table comprising a set of aggregate data used to form a column of the relational table joined to other columns formed from the sets of input data specified by the abstract derived entity. The resulting abstract derived table may be queried as though it were an actual relational table stored in a physical data source.
